Subject: [PATCH] ARM: dts: imx7s-warp: enable i2c3 device support
Date: Fri, 17 Aug 2018 23:23:17 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1534540997-20094-1-git-send-email-texier.pj2@gmail.com> (raw)
The WaRP7 has one mikroBUS socket on the back to plug click boards.
This patch allows to interact with some of these
i2c modules (EEPROM, RTC and so on).

arch/arm/boot/dts/imx7s-warp.dts | 14 ++++++++++++++
1 file changed, 14 insertions(+)
diff --git a/arch/arm/boot/dts/imx7s-warp.dts b/arch/arm/boot/dts/imx7s-warp.dts
index fa390da..b3d0951 100644
--- a/arch/arm/boot/dts/imx7s-warp.dts
+++ b/arch/arm/boot/dts/imx7s-warp.dts
@@ -216,6 +216,13 @@
status = "okay";
};
+&i2c3 {
+ clock-frequency = <100000>;
+ pinctrl-names = "default";
+ pinctrl-0 = <&pinctrl_i2c3>;
+ status = "okay";
+};
+
&i2c4 {
clock-frequency = <100000>;
pinctrl-names = "default";
@@ -346,6 +353,13 @@
>;
};
+ pinctrl_i2c3: i2c3grp {
+ fsl,pins = <
+ MX7D_PAD_I2C3_SDA__I2C3_SDA 0x4000007f
+ MX7D_PAD_I2C3_SCL__I2C3_SCL 0x4000007f
+ >;
+ };
+
pinctrl_i2c4: i2c4grp {
fsl,pins = <
MX7D_PAD_I2C4_SCL__I2C4_SCL 0x4000007f
